All 4 models will be available in 40mm and 44mm (XL) sizes. All new luminous technology on these! The dials are 3D. I am working on a drawing to demonstrate the technology but rest assured, its amazing! The cases are solid Cobalt Chromium material. The actual scratch resistance is similar to tungsten carbide but the strength of the material is much greater. Weight is slightly heavier than stainless steel and it has the appearance of platinum. Its a very bright metal. All will be 9015 automatic powered. All will have standard sapphire casebacks and will include a high quality leather and rubber strap. Pre-order will open for all new models later this month.
